Alleged Deepfake Investment Scam in Spain Defrauds 208 Victims of €19 million ($20.9 million)
2025-04-07
Spanish police arrested six individuals allegedly behind a €19M ($20.9M) global investment scam powered by AI. The operation used deepfake ads featuring national celebrities to deceive victims, many of whom were selected through targeting algorithms. Scammers posed as financial advisors and fake officials, cycling through romance baiting, investment fraud, and recovery scams. AI-generated content amplified trust and engagement.

Purportedly AI-Powered 007TG Platform Reportedly Used by Scam Networks Linked to $75 Million in Proceeds
2024-04-01
007TG was a software suite reportedly used by scam compounds to run fraud across social media, using AI-assisted messaging and translation to help operators manage targets while concealing their identities. Wallet records linked the platform to at least four known scam networks that collectively received at least $75 million, though the evidence does not show how much was directly attributable to 007TG.
